Paradise Valley
This small community is often thought of as
a northern extension of Scottsdale because it offers a very
similar lifestyle with the focus on a tourist economy and
high-class housing that has become typical of Scottsdale.
The tourism-based economy is centered
around the area’s twelve major resorts which make Paradise
valley one of the most attractive tourist destinations in an
area known for tourism. The proximity of Paradise Valley to
Scottsdale and its location in the Phoenix Metropolitan area
make it very convenient to many golf courses and sporting venues
which are popular among locals and tourists alike.
The area is appealing enough to have drawn
celebrities ranging from politicians (Dan Quale), actors (Leslie
Nielsen) and professional atheletes (Marc Grace) among others.
Paradise Valley is also notable in having adopted the city of
Bay St. Louis in the wake of Hurricane Katrina, donating police
cars, computer equipment and manpower to the recovery effort.
The community is also committed to the
ecological preservation of its surroundings. The Mummy Mountain
Preserve Trust is a local organization whose goal is to preserve
the natural landscape of the mountainous area, including the
desert plant and wildlife.
Paradise Valley is home to a memorial for Barry
M. Goldwater, former US Senator and Presidential candidate. The
memorial includes a statue of Mr. Goldwater which was sculpted
by local artist, Joe Beeler
